The increasing complexity of infrastructure projects and their environments has necessitated greater flexibility to adapt to changing circumstances and unexpected events (Leendertse et al., 2022 and Giezen et al., 2014). However, in practice, a tendency toward a control-oriented approach persists, where deviations from predefined project objectives are viewed as undesirable due to their associated time and cost implications (Koppenjan et al., 2011). Therefore, this study aimed to find the flexibility enablers and blockers in practice that can help or prevent a project organization to adapt well to the changing circumstances. Through asking interviewees about their responses towards unexpected events, insights into the flexibility enablers and blockers in practice have come to light. It was concluded that flexibility is enabled by the individuals working within the project organizations. Flexibility extends down to the personal level. Therefore, trust, stakeholder inclusion, and collaboration are highly important. Although the human aspect of flexibility is crucial, practical enhancements can also be made.
